Energy Efficiency

Refrigeration requires electricity, and it doesn’t come free. A faulty cold storage door will allow cold air to escape, and your system will have to use more electricity to maintain the target temperature. In a tiny home fridge, this extra electricity won’t amount to very much, but for something as huge as a walk-in cold storage system, you could be throwing away a ton of money every month.

Comfort

If cold air is leaking through your cold storage door, then it’s going to cool the rest of your facility. Your employees and guests may become cold, and you’ll have to turn up the heat just to compensate. Comfortable employees work harder, and you don’t want your guests to shiver.
